A.made from the flower of “κύπρος, ἔλαιον” Edict. Diocl.Delph. 10:—esp. as Subst. κύπρι^νον (sc. μύρον), τό, oil or unguent made from the flower of the κύπρος, Apollon.Heroph. ap. Ath.15.688f, Dsc.1.55, Aret.CA1.2; also of a plaster, Androm. ap. Gal.13.494.
